Under the direction of the Manager or designate and in collaboration as a member of a multidisciplinary team, the Licensed Practical Nurse, Full Scope performs assessments, plans and provides personal care, and performs nursing procedures. The Licensed Practical Nurse, Full Scope operates in accordance with the competency guidelines and full scope of practice within the Standards of Practice as outlined by the BC College of Nurses and Midwives, and according to agency operating policies and standards and unit specific protocols.
Registration with BC College of Nurses and Midwives as a practicing LPN registrant.
Perinatal positions: completion of a perinatal education program plus breastfeeding course OR 1 year of recent (within last 2 years) acute perinatal experience.
Perinatal positions: Neonatal Resuscitation Program (NRP) certification within the past 2 years.
MHSU positions: additional education as outlined by BCCNM for practice where Mental Health and/or Substance Use disorders are primary diagnosis.
Hip and Knee Clinic positions: two (2) years' recent related surgical and preadmission clinic experience OR equ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.
